Description

Also in the hobby since spring 2017 is the Blue Tiger Crab or Blue Kong . It was scientifically described as a new species in 2018 by Chris Lukhaup. What was formerly known as Cherax peknyi "Blue Kong" is now called Cherax alyciae. This beautiful crayfish is native to Papua, where it is found in small rivers and streams in hard, calcareous water. The Blue Kong is not as colorful as other Papuan crayfish, but its deep blue color makes it an attractive, beautiful animal. The orange joints of the claw arms contrast classily with the deep blue. The carapace and claws are a slightly lighter blue, and the color then fades to a deep, rich indigo toward the abdomen and legs. The segments there are set off with light blue narrow horizontal stripes - this variety of tiger crayfish is a bit more subtle, but still striped. On the underside, the large claws are sometimes heavily hairy. The Blue Kong can reach a body length of up to 14 cm and thus belongs to the medium-sized Cherax species.

Blue Kong males have large, strong claws, the claws of the females are not so massive. Males and females can be reliably identified by the gonopores (sexual orifices), which are located at the base of the third stride leg pair in front of the abdomen in males, and at the base of the last stride leg pair in front of the abdomen in females.

Cherax alyciae "Blue Kong" is well suited for socialization with peaceful ornamental fish that do not sleep on the bottom, although depending on their character, a fish may be preyed upon once in a while. With dwarf shrimps, which fit to the water values, it can be kept together very well. Snails and mussels are cracked and eaten, they belong also in the biotope to the natural prey of the beautiful crayfish. Never put crayfish of different species or varieties together. With other Cherax together it can come to indefinable hybrids and mixtures! With American crayfish and with the water in which American crayfish live, Cherax from Papua must not come into contact under any circumstances. These crayfish can transmit the crayfish plague, from which the blue tiger crayfish would inevitably and 100% die. With crabs and large arm shrimps it can come to deadly fights, fan shrimps are hunted and eaten - also with these animals the Blue Kong should not be kept.

The Blue Kong tolerates a wide range of water values. The pH should be between 7 and 8 and the temperature should be permanently above 20 °C. 25 °C should not be exceeded in the long run.

A pair of the beautiful blue colored Blue Kong fits perfectly in an aquarium from 80 cm length. Set up the tank varied and offer the animals hiding places and also possibilities to visually get out of their way. Cherax peknyi is not known to be an excessive herbivore, so you can certainly design an aquarium for the Blue Tiger Crab with robust, fast-growing plants. Bring in decorations and furnishings so that they cannot tip over and damage the glass when buried, or even crush the crayfish. The aquarium needs an absolutely tight fitting lid. Cherax alyciae "Blue Kong" are very good, strong climbers. Also in nature they leave the water from time to time.

Not yet adult Cherax alyciae "Blue Kong" need a lot of protein and should therefore also get a portion of animal food, while adult Blue Tiger Crayfish need mainly vegetable food. Too much protein can quickly lead to moulting problems and death.

The reproduction of Cherax alyciae "Blue Kong" works like with the other variants of the tiger crayfish. The females of the Blue Tiger Crab carry 40-80 eggs on their swimming legs under the abdomen until the hatching of the young, which can take up to 6 weeks. After hatching, the baby crayfish stay with the mother for a few hours to days and then go off on their own. Since they are strongly cannibalistic among themselves also juvenile and adult blue tiger crayfish do not say no to a small protein snack, a separate breeding tank with a thick layer of brown autumn leaves and many hiding places such as perforated bricks is advisable.

Profile
Scientific name Cherax alyciae "Blue Kong" Lukhaup & Herbert, 2008
German Name: Blue Kong, Cherax Blue Kong, Blue Tiger Crab, Blue Kong Tiger Crab
Difficulty level: suitable for beginners
Origin/Distribution: Papua/Indonesia
Coloration: bright blue claws and carapace, changing to a deep indigo blue on the abdomen and legs, joints of the claw arms dark orange, abdomen with narrow light blue horizontal stripes
Age expectancy 2 to 5 years
Water parameters: GH from 6, KH to 8, pH 6 to 7.5, temperature 20 to 28 °C
Tank size: from 80 l for a pair, but we recommend a size of at least 112 l for successful breeding
Food brown autumn leaves, Natureholic crayfish feed, frozen food, vegetables, green food (spinach, nettle), protein food
Propagation not difficult, after seven to nine weeks 40 to 80 young crayfish hatch
Behavior compatible
Socialization with shrimps, possibly with peaceful medium sized fishes
